- 博客(12)
- 收藏
- 关注
原创 pg数据库设置相关列自增长
设置自增长序列号CREATE SEQUENCE employee_id_seqSTART WITH 1INCREMENT BY 1NO MINVALUENO MAXVALUECACHE 1;关联表alter table employee alter column id set default nextval(‘employee_id_seq’);查询当前序列号SELECT nextval(‘employee_id_seq’);改变序列号初始值alter sequence
2020-05-12 14:56:33 405 1
原创 原生js节点元素替换
HTML部分<table> <tr> <td class="d"> 1231 </td> <td class="a"> <input type="text" value="1"> </td> <td class="b"> <input...
2020-02-28 10:20:05 1060
原创 docker中运行mysql
本人小白,第一次接触docker。爬了半天坑,终于爬出来了。重要心得:运行命令的顺序很重要,真的很重要!!!docker run --name cmysql -v home/mysql/db:/var/lib/m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 -d mysql:5.7-e MYSQL_ROOT_PASSWORD=1234...
2020-02-28 10:03:24 115
原创 apply()与call()的共同点和区别
JavaScript中的每一个Function对象都有一个apply()方法和一个call()方法apply() 调用一个具有给定this值的函数,以及作为一个数组(或类似数组对象)提供的参数call() 使用一个指定的 this 值和单独给出的一个或多个参数来调用一个函数共同点:call()方法的作用和 apply() 方法类似,区别就是call()方法接受的是参数列表,而apply()...
2019-06-04 10:49:11 441
原创 js 所有分割截取总结
因为老是记不住所以特定总结一下即使要翻 以后也方便一点splice() 从一个数组中移除一个或多个元素,若有必要在移除元素的位置上插入新元素,返回所移除的元素。注释:该方法会改变原始数组。语法:arrayObject.splice(index,howmany,item1,…,itemX)var arr = ["George", "John", "Thomas", "James", ...
2019-06-03 16:30:31 7520
原创 求100000以内的完美数(因子之和等于本身)
/*** 求100000以内的完美数(因子之和等于本身)**/for(var a=2; a<100000; a++) { /*给a输入2到100000的数*/ var c=0; for(var b=1;b<a;b++) { /*给b输入1到a减1的数*/ if(a%b == 0) { /*判断b是否是a的因数*/ c = c+b; /*是,则将b累加*/ if...
2019-05-20 16:10:39 1304
原创 遍历多维数组
/*** 遍历多维数组**/var array = [[2], 2, [[3]]];var newArray = [];function traverseArray(obj){ for(var i in obj) { if(typeof(obj[i]) !== 'object'){ newArray.push(obj[i]); }else { traverseAr...
2019-05-20 16:09:34 129
原创 判断数组中出现次数最多和第二多的元素
// arr 传入的数组function querySameSize(arr) { var hash=[];// 使用哈希数组 for(var i=0;i<arr.length;i++){ if(!hash[arr[i].grading]) {// 没有初始化的数组元素为undefined,undefined++为NaN hash[arr[i].g...
2019-04-04 14:23:14 1258
原创 解决跨域
报错:Request header field content-type is not allowed by Access-Control-Allow-Headers in preflight response.后端需要Servlet来实现doOptions方法来处理这个请求。解决方法:在doOptions方法中添加:response.setHeader("Access-Con...
2019-03-26 14:18:14 117
转载 Ajax中POST和GET的区别
Get和Post都是向服务器发送的一种请求,只是发送机制不同。1. GET请求会将参数跟在URL后进行传递,而POST请求则是作为HTTP消息的实体内容发送给WEB服务器。当然在Ajax请求中,这种区别对用户是不可见的。2. 首先是"GET方式提交的数据最多只能是1024字节",因为GET是通过URL提交数据,那么GET可提交的数据量就跟URL的长度有直接关系了。而实际上,URL不存在参...
2019-03-20 16:25:12 759
原创 原生 js 排序
/**数组根据数组对象中的某个属性值进行排序的方法 * 使用例子:newArray.sort(sortNumber('asc', 'data')) //表示根据data属性升序排列; * @param order desc(降序)、asc(升序) * @param sortBy 排序的属性 * */ var sortNumber = function (order,...
2019-03-20 15:27:48 376
原创 数组相关操作
// 查询Array.prototype.indexOf = function(o,prop) { var val; if(typeof(o) === "object") { val = o[prop]; } else { val = o; } var tmp; for(var i = 0; i < this.length; i++) { ...
2019-03-20 15:16:55 81
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人